RCV000815499 | SCV000955957 | uncertain significance | Cortical dysplasia-focal epilepsy syndrome | 2022-09-01 | criteria provided, single submitter | clinical testing | In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. Experimental studies have shown that this missense change does not substantially affect CNTNAP2 function (PMID: 22872700, 29788201). Algorithms developed to predict the effect of missense changes on protein structure and function output the following: SIFT: "Deleterious"; PolyPhen-2: "Benign"; Align-GVGD: "Class C0". The aspartic acid amino acid residue is found in multiple mammalian species, which suggests that this missense change does not adversely affect protein function. ClinVar contains an entry for this variant (Variation ID: 658643). This missense change has been observed in individual(s) with autism spectrum disorder (ASD) (PMID: 18179895). This variant is present in population databases (rs772179690, gnomAD 0.0009%). This sequence change replaces asparagine, which is neutral and polar, with aspartic acid, which is acidic and polar, at codon 418 of the CNTNAP2 protein (p.Asn418Asp). |
